Various Artists

Folksound FS 100 (LP, UK, 1974)

Recorded by Bernard Whitty in the Music Room of Schallenge House, Bromyard, Austin House, Nantwich, and the Folksound Studios, Halsall, in September and October 1974;
Sleeve Design by Peter Bellamy;
Produced by Fred Woods
